How to Connect Skullcandy Wireless Headphones to Bluetooth

1. Turn on Your Skullcandy Headphones
Before you begin, make sure your Skullcandy wireless headphones are turned on. Press and hold the power button on the headphones until you hear a beep, indicating that they are powered on.
2. Put Your Headphones in Pairing Mode
To pair your Skullcandy headphones with a Bluetooth device, you need to put them in pairing mode. Here’s how to do it:
– For most Skullcandy models, press and hold the volume down button for a few seconds until you hear a beep.
– Some models may require you to press and hold the power button for a few seconds.
Once you hear the beep, your headphones are now in pairing mode and ready to connect to a Bluetooth device.
3. Turn on Bluetooth on Your Device
Next, turn on Bluetooth on your smartphone, tablet, or computer. This process may vary depending on the device you are using. Here’s how to enable Bluetooth on some common devices:
– For Android devices, go to Settings > Bluetooth and toggle the switch to turn it on.
– For iOS devices, go to Settings > Bluetooth and make sure the Bluetooth switch is turned on.
– For Windows 10 computers, go to Settings > Devices > Bluetooth & other devices and turn on Bluetooth.
4. Pair Your Skullcandy Headphones with Your Device
Now that your headphones and device are both in Bluetooth mode, it’s time to pair them. Follow these steps:
– On your device, swipe down from the top of the screen (or click on the Bluetooth icon in the system tray) to view available Bluetooth devices.
– Look for your Skullcandy headphones in the list of devices. The name of your headphones may vary depending on the model, but it typically includes the Skullcandy brand name.
– Select your headphones from the list and wait for a confirmation message on your device, indicating that the pairing process is complete.

If you ever need to disconnect your headphones from Bluetooth, simply go to the Bluetooth settings on your device and select “Forget device” or “Remove device” for your Skullcandy headphones.
